The Germany ultrasound devices market was valued at USD 541.80 million in 2021 and is projected to register a CAGR of 5.70% during the forecast period (2022-2027).

COVID-19 had an adverse impact on the ultrasound devices market in Germany. The study, "Collateral Effect of COVID-19 on Orthopaedic and Trauma Surgery," set out to evaluate and investigate how the COVID-19 pandemic affected orthopedic and trauma surgery in Germany's private practices and hospitals. In this cross-sectional study, an anonymous online poll was conducted from April 2 to April 16, 2020. 150,000 orthopedic and trauma doctors from hospitals and private practices across Germany's 18,000 facilities were included in the study. All members of the Professional Association for Orthopedic and Trauma Surgery (PAOTS) and the German Society of Orthopedic and Trauma Surgery (DGOU) received the survey (BVOU). The study included 858 orthopedic and trauma specialists from throughout Germany. According to the study, orthopedic and trauma surgery have been most impacted by the COVID-19 epidemic in Germany. The containment efforts are generally considered to be prudent despite severe financial constraints. The results of multiple regression analysis show that surgeons who work for themselves are more impacted by scarcity and its financial ramifications than surgeons who work in hospitals. As a result, there was a negative influence on the demand for ultrasound scans needed for orthopedic and trauma cases in need of diagnosis, which restrained the market's expansion. Due to the aforementioned circumstances, the nation has seen several difficulties with diagnostic screenings; however, it is anticipated that the business will recover in the coming years.

Over the course of the study's projection period, the increased prevalence of chronic conditions such as cardiovascular disorders, technical developments, and the launch of new products are expected to have the most impact on the growth of the ultrasound devices market in Germany. According to a report titled "German Heart Surgery Report 2020: The Annual Updated Registry of the German Society for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ery" that was published by the National Library of Medicine in June 2021, there were 843 assist device implantations (including left/right/biventricular assist device, total artificial device) in Germany in 2020. There were also approximately 29,444 isolated coronary artery bypass grafting procedures, 35,469 isolated heart valve procedures, and approximately 29,444 total artificial device procedures. This demonstrates a high prevalence of cardiovascular disorders in the nation, which is anticipated to fuel the expansion of the market under study in the nation. Similarly, initiatives by market players are another factor in market growth. In November 20201, Siemens Healthineers, based in Germany, introduced a new advanced liver analysis feature with ACUSON Sequoia ultrasound system. It provides clinicians with a new measurement tool called ultrasound derived fat fraction (UDFF), which helps them evaluate the severity of hepatic steatosis overall. The system also includes Auto Point Shear Wave Elastography (Auto pSWE), a brand-new method for quantifying liver stiffness that aims to shorten the duration of the liver elastography exam. Additionally, the development of 3D ultrasound technology by the German company TOMTEC led to a revolution in diagnostic ultrasound. Through clever automation and web-based diagnostic workflows, TOMTEC is now poised to completely transform echocardiography once more. Thus, the abovementioned factors are expected to increase market growth.

Key Market TrendsRadiology Segment is Expected to Hold a Significant Market Share Over the Forecast Period

Ultrasound is one of a number of techniques referred to as "interventional radiology" (IR) that rely on the use of radiological image guidance. Using targeted minimally invasive treatments carried out with image guidance, interventional oncology is a specialization of interventional radiology that deals with the detection and treatment of cancer and cancer-related disorders. Factors such as the increasing prevalence of cancer and initiatives by key market players are expected to increase the market growth. For instance, according to the GlOBOCAN 2020 data, Germany saw 628,519 new cases of cancer in 2020, and by 2040, this number is predicted to rise to 749,559 instances. As ultrasound instruments are widely employed in the diagnosis of many types of cancer, the anticipated increase in cancer cases will propel the use of ultrasound imaging in the nation. Initiatives by key market players are expected to increase market growth. With Paracelsus Clinics in Germany, Philips entered into an eight-year strategic partnership in March 2020. Through this partnership, Philips will offer solutions that make imaging systems more accessible and use digitization and process optimization to boost quality and efficiency. A similar range of diagnostic goods and services, including computed tomography, magnetic resonsce interface, X-ray, artificial intelligence, endoscopy, and ultrasound systems, was introduced in July 2021 by FUJIFILM Healthcare Europe and FUJIFILM Europe's existing European medical company. Therefore, the ultrasound devices market is expected to grow in Germany during the forecast period of the study.

Competitive Landscape

Germany ultrasound devices market is moderately competitive and consists of several major players. Some of the companies that are currently dominating the market are Canon Medical Systems Corporation, GE Healthcare, Fujifilm Holdings Corporation, Siemens Healthineers AG, and Koninklijke Philips NV among others.
